Hi team,

Welcome aboard. As part of the Quillbarrow integration, we are migrating shared containers to slimmed base images to cut pull times. Please rebuild your connector against the new minimal image and confirm no missing system libraries. Detailed steps are in the integration guide. When testing pushes to our staging registry, authenticate using the bearer token below.

session JWT of tadup-kaguf = eyJhbGciOiJIUzI1NiIsInR5cCI6IkpXVCJ9.eyJzdWIiOiItNz4V3In0.KrZCeqpk

Ticket: Config drift on ProctorLine exam queue. Staging and prod disagree on retry backoff and session timeout for the proctoring queue workers in the Vexley cluster. Drift likely introduced during last week's hotfix; the ansible run was skipped. Candidates are being re-queued twice under load. Need support to confirm which side is canonical before we re-sync. Current prod values as pulled from the live node follow below.

settings of yahaf-tahop:
jorox:
  pin: 5851
  tenant: noveth
  seal: seal_7ddb5c42
  metrics_host: metrics.jorox.ordinnet.example
  standby_team: wenax
  escalation: oliath-feneth
  nonce: 552548

Building access – guest Wi-Fi desk

Team assistants hosting visitors at Fennick Row should direct them to the guest Wi-Fi desk at reception, to the left of the turnstiles. Visitors register a device there and receive a day pass for the network; no staff credentials are ever shared. The desk is staffed 08:30–17:00. Outside those hours, assistants can open the desk's terminal cabinet themselves and print a pass, using the access code below.

badge for haduf-bafop: bdg-O-78

### v4.2.0 — Changed defaults

Heads up, plugin authors: Pylon Gateway's health checks behind the balancer got stricter. We now require two consecutive passes before marking a node healthy, and the probe path moved off the root route. If your plugin registers custom probes, update them accordingly. The new defaults ship as the following configuration.

service settings:
[casax]
port = 6379
team = rusir
host = casax.zemvarhq.corp
region = outer-4
access_code = ac_9808ce
timeout_ms = 1500